How to change device parameters
Set-up menu title
Shows the path to the currently selected menu. Note that the parameter should be included
in the settings menu title. For example:
Setup> Communication>HTTP> Port
is different from
Setup> Communication>FTP>Data Port
.
Navigation area
Selection of branches / parameters is made in this area. The selected item is highlighted. All
parameters are listed on the left side of the navigational area. All parameter values are displayed
on the right side against the parameter name. As the branches have no values associated, tree dots
are shown instead. This indicates that a transition to a sub-menu is available.
Front panel buttons usage:
[OK] – Depending on the selected menu element can perform different actions:
•
Menu branch – transition to selected sub-menu will be made;
•
Menu parameter – when the name of a parameter is illuminated, pressing [OK] will highlight
the value and switch to edit mode;
•
Menu complex parameter (such as
Alarm
) – the parameter editor screen will be shown.
[UP] / [DOWN] – If edit mode is active, the value of the selected parameter will be changed.
Otherwise, are used for navigation through the menu;
[LEFT] / [RIGHT] – Change the selection when the parameter value is in edit mode;
[SB4] – Return one level up or cancel edit mode.
There are several parameter types available in DB7001. The way of editing depends of the
parameter type. Every parameter type has its own editing rules.
Numerical parameter
Represents numerical value.
Example: The value
Frequency
can be changed in the range of
87.10 MHz
to
108.10 MHz
and
Frequency Step
of
10 kHz
,
20 kHz
,
50 kHz
,
100 kHz
and
200 kHz
.
Front panel buttons usage:
[UP] / [DOWN] – Change the value of the parameter with one step. The step value may vary
depending on the selected parameter. The value always stays in permitted parameter range;
[OK] – Accept the changed value and exit edit mode;
[SB4] – will discard the value and cancel edit mode.
Enumerated parameter
Represent the selection of a value among set of predefined enumerated values.
Example: The value
De-emphasis
can be selected from
Flat
,
50µs
, and
75µs
.
Front panel buttons usage:
[UP] / [DOWN] – Cycle through the possible values;
[OK] – Accept the changed value and exit edit mode;
[SB4] – will discard the value and cancel edit mode.
